Pros

There are no pros to list

Cons

pay is far below the national average. the company does not do raises for merit or cost of living. employees are constantly pressured to do things that are not their job and take on extra work without extra pay. training documents are missing or incomplete at best. management is inconsistent with its adherence to policy and procedure. benefits are the very barest of minimums. there is a high turnover rate because of the lack of support and respect for employees.
